CONDITIONS AFFECTING OPERATION - 6
CAUTION
Prolonged WOT operation will shorten the life of
your engine and could cause premature engine
failure. See NORMAL CRUISING SPEEDS in
SPECIFICATIONS. Problems caused by prolonged
WOT operation are considered abuse and are not
covered under the PCM Warranty.
PROPELLER SELECTION
Best all-around performance and maximum engine life is
achieved when the engine is propped to run near the top
of (but within) the recommended full throttle RPM range
with a normal load. See ENGINE SPECIFICATIONS for
rated full throttle RPM for your model engine.
Generally, gross weight (total weight of the entire
boat, including full fuel and water, optional equipment,
passengers and other miscellaneous gear) is one of
the major factors and should be one of the primary
considerations when selecting a propeller. Other factors
to take into consideration are as follows:
Warmer weather and higher humidity will cause
an RPM loss.
Operating the boat in a higher elevation will
cause an RPM loss.
Operating the boat with an increased load
will cause an RPM loss (additional equipment,
passengers, etc.).
If full throttle RPM is above or below the recommended
range as stated in ENGINE SPECIFICATIONS,
the propeller must be changed to prevent loss of
performance. A one-inch change in the pitch of a given
propeller will generally change engine RPM by 150 to
250 RPM.
ENGINE RPM CHART
IMPORTANT NOTICE: Your new PCM engine
incorporates an RPM “MAX GOVERNOR” in order
to prevent the engine from over-revving. Operation
above the Maximum RPM listed, in the chart above,
is not recommended. If your engine is operating
above the maximum RPM listed, a higher pitched
propeller would be required to lower the engine
maximum RPM to the Preferred RPM listed in the
chart above.
Minimum
Model Full Load Preferred Maximum
HO303 4800 4900 5000
EX343 5000 5200 5300
ZR409/ZR450 5400 5500 5600
